西湖:双浦“村BA”收官,带火文旅消费
Hang Zhou Ri Bao· 2025-08-22 02:27
下午5点,总决赛尚未开场,东江嘴村健身广场上已是一番热闹景象,一场汇聚双浦特色的乡村市 集提前聚拢人气。 省级非遗九曲红梅红茶、九曲红梅冰激凌、九曲红梅啤酒……走进市集,首先感受到的是迎面而来 的阵阵茶香。"没想到在双浦,茶叶能玩出这么多花样,不仅有常规认知的红茶,还有各种衍生产品, 非常新奇的一次体验。"从富阳特意赶来看球的球迷陈先生笑着说道。 总决赛现场,一名金发碧眼的姑娘吸引了大家的目光。原来,杭州国际青年创意营成员、"海外达 人"卡丽娜循着加油呐喊声,来到现场与球迷一起感受夏夜的火热激情。"我把今天逛市集和观赛的体验 拍成了视频,让更多粉丝和网友能感受民间赛事的风采,吹江风喝红茶看比赛,太惬意了!" "本届'村BA'上演了67场精彩比拼,现场观赛球迷破5万人次,现场服务的志愿者超400人次。"双浦 镇社会事务办负责人介绍道,"总决赛前,CBA明星球员孙铭徽为我们录制了呼吁文明观赛的视频,我 们也准备了文明观赛的手牌分发给球迷,在多方合力下,总决赛氛围热烈又井然有序,展现了乡村的文 明风貌。" 总决赛比赛现场 卡丽娜在市集玩嗨了 开场灯光秀、扣篮表演和硕大的电子屏幕,酷炫程度堪比全明星周末;锣鼓表演、村 ...
7月全社会用电量创新高 透过用电量突破看我国产业发展新趋势
Yang Shi Wang· 2025-08-22 01:57
Core Insights - In July, China's total electricity consumption reached 10,226 billion kilowatt-hours, marking a year-on-year increase of 8.6%, and this is the first time monthly consumption has surpassed the trillion-kilowatt-hour mark [1][3] - The growth in electricity consumption reflects new trends in industrial development, driven by high temperatures and stable industrial production [1][3] Electricity Consumption by Sector - The primary sector consumed 17 billion kilowatt-hours, up 20.2% year-on-year; the secondary sector consumed 5,936 billion kilowatt-hours, up 4.7%; and the tertiary sector consumed 2,081 billion kilowatt-hours, up 10.7% [3][5] - The secondary sector's electricity consumption showed a continuous recovery, with a growth rate of 4.7%, an increase of 1.5 percentage points from the previous month [5] High-Technology and Service Industries - The electricity consumption in high-tech and equipment manufacturing industries is leading the growth, while the internet and related services saw a significant increase of 28.2% year-on-year [5] - The new energy vehicle manufacturing sector also experienced a substantial growth of 25.7% in electricity consumption [5] Emerging Consumption Drivers - New electricity consumption drivers include data centers, electric vehicle charging services, and the sports economy, particularly in regions like Zhejiang, Jiangsu, and Guangdong [5][9] - In Jiangsu, the restaurant industry's electricity consumption surged over 25% year-on-year, driven by events like local football leagues [7] Peak Load and Energy Management - High temperatures have led to record electricity loads in several regions, prompting the State Grid to enhance cross-regional power transmission and initiate residential energy-saving actions [10][11] - In Anhui, the peak load reached 68.57 million kilowatts, a 7.92% increase from the previous year, while Jiangsu's peak load also set a new record at 156 million kilowatts, up 6.12% year-on-year [11]
“苏超”是这样带动380亿元消费的
Jiang Nan Shi Bao· 2025-08-21 15:33
Core Insights - The "Su Super" event has significantly boosted local consumption, generating 38 billion yuan in economic value, showcasing the integration of sports with culture, tourism, and commerce [1] - The development of sports events has transitioned from government-led initiatives to market-driven and community-participated models, which is fundamental to their economic impact [2] - The "Su Super" event has catalyzed a series of promotional activities across Jiangsu, leading to substantial increases in consumer traffic and sales in various commercial areas [3] Group 1 - The "Su Super" event attracted over 60,000 attendees in a single match, contributing to a total consumption of 38 billion yuan across Jiangsu [1] - In the first half of the year, 511 key sports events across seven regions generated over 16 billion yuan in related consumption, averaging over 30 million yuan per event [1] - During the Hangzhou Asian Games, surrounding areas experienced consumption growth of over 40% [1] Group 2 - The "Su Super" event has seen vibrant participation, with nearly 25,000 fans attending a match in Taizhou, and related activities generating over 100,000 yuan in sales within three hours [2] - The "Su Super" event's viewing points across 16 commercial complexes attracted a total of 280,000 visitors, with a week-on-week increase of over 60% in foot traffic [2] - The "Su Super" event has led to a 13.03% year-on-year increase in consumer traffic and a 10.22% increase in sales in Nanjing's commercial areas during the event period [3]
赛事经济蓬勃发展 体育总局:积极支持“浙BA”等群众赛事
Zhong Guo Jing Ying Bao· 2025-08-20 23:18
Core Insights - The rise of community sports events like "Su Chao," "Village Super," and "Zhe BA" has significantly boosted local economies and consumer spending, becoming new engines for economic growth [1][2][5] - The National Sports Administration supports the integration of mass sports and competitive sports, aiming to revitalize the "three major ball sports" through community events [1][2] Group 1: Economic Impact of Sports Events - "Su Chao" has attracted over 1 million spectators, generating approximately 379.6 billion yuan in revenue across various sectors, marking a 42.7% year-on-year increase [3][4] - The "Zhe BA" basketball league has drawn 778,800 attendees during its preliminary phase, leading to a total consumption of 6.03 billion yuan [4] - The "Village Super" event in Guizhou has created nearly 200 billion yuan in tourism revenue over two years, showcasing its potential as a local economic driver [5] Group 2: Government Support and Policy Initiatives - The "14th Five-Year Plan" emphasizes the construction of a sports event system, promoting the integration of sports with culture, tourism, and commerce [2][6] - The National Sports Administration has introduced four industry standards and plans to release a national standard for safety assessments in mass sports events, enhancing the regulatory framework [6] - Future policies will focus on enriching event offerings, enhancing brand influence, and fostering coordination between events and industries to stimulate consumption and economic growth [6]

运河观察|百天“苏超”激活江苏消费经济新引擎
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-08-20 14:25
Group 1: Core Insights - The "Su Super" league has significantly boosted consumer spending in Jiangsu, generating 38 billion yuan in economic activity [2] - The league has become a focal point for local businesses, driving foot traffic and sales in various sectors [3][4] - The event has transformed into a powerful economic engine, enhancing both consumption and industrial upgrades across Jiangsu [9] Group 2: Consumer Impact - Local businesses have leveraged the "Su Super" event to attract customers, with promotions linked to ticket holders leading to increased sales [3] - The number of visitors to live viewing events reached 7.15 million, a 13.03% increase year-on-year, with sales exceeding 4.04 billion yuan, up 10.22% [4] - The event has created a vibrant ecosystem of "core venues + all-region consumption," stimulating local economies [4] Group 3: Industrial Upgrades - The surge in football-related activities has activated Jiangsu's manufacturing sector, particularly in football production and logistics [5] - Companies like Suqian Jingcheng Sports Goods Co. are seeing increased domestic demand for football equipment, with an annual production of 2 million footballs, 80% of which are exported [5] - Technological advancements in sports infrastructure, such as the development of environmentally friendly artificial turf, are being driven by the demand generated from the league [6] Group 4: Broader Economic Effects - The "Su Super" league has influenced various local markets, with cities like Suzhou leading in air conditioning and fans, while Xuzhou excels in barbecue supplies [8] - The event has expanded its influence beyond sports, integrating with local commerce through initiatives like the "Su Goods Carnival" and online consumption platforms [8] - The league has also facilitated international engagement by inviting foreign executives to matches, enhancing the city's global profile [8]

国家体育总局:截至2024年底体育领域国家级专精特新“小巨人”企业达146家
Zheng Quan Ri Bao· 2025-08-19 23:30
Core Insights - The sports industry in China has shown a steady growth with an average annual growth rate exceeding 10% over the past five years, reaching a total scale of 3.67 trillion yuan in 2023, with a value added of 1.49 trillion yuan [1] Economic Contribution - The value added of the national sports industry has grown at an average annual rate of 11.6%, accounting for 1.15% of GDP in 2023, moving closer to becoming a pillar industry [1] - The ice and snow industry has expanded from 381.1 billion yuan in 2020 to 970 billion yuan in 2024, with an average annual growth rate of 26.3% [1] - The total sports consumption in 40 pilot cities has increased by over 100 billion yuan from 2020 to 2023, indicating a continuous release of sports consumption potential [1] Structural Quality Improvement - The structure of the sports industry is improving, with the sports service sector, led by competition performance and fitness leisure, increasing its share of the industry's value added from 68.7% in 2020 to 72.7% in 2023 [2] - The number of national-level specialized and innovative "little giant" enterprises in the sports sector is expected to reach 146 by the end of 2024, more than doubling from the end of 2022 [2] - High-tech products such as carbon fiber bicycles and smart fitness equipment are increasingly entering households, enhancing innovation and competitiveness in the sports manufacturing sector [2] Outdoor Sports Industry Development - The online consumption of outdoor sports is projected to reach approximately 200 million participants and over 300 billion yuan in total consumption by 2024 [2] - As of 2024, there are 171,800 fitness trails totaling 407,500 kilometers, and 2,055 flying and automotive camps across the country [3] - The water sports industry is expected to see participation exceed 120 million people, with a market size of 438.6 billion yuan, reflecting an 18.7% year-on-year growth [3] Event-Driven Economic Impact - In the first half of this year, key sporting events in seven provinces generated over 16 billion yuan in related consumption, averaging over 30 million yuan per event, playing a significant role in expanding domestic demand [4] - The National Sports Administration plans to develop policies to promote event economics, enhance event supply, and strengthen the coordination between events and the industry [4]
体育服务消费市场正在崛起
2 1 Shi Ji Jing Ji Bao Dao· 2025-08-19 23:09
Core Insights - The sports industry has become a significant driver of economic growth in China, with an average annual growth rate exceeding 10% over the past five years [1] - The value added by the sports industry has grown at an average rate of 11.6% since the start of the 14th Five-Year Plan, reaching 1.15% of GDP in 2023, moving closer to becoming a pillar industry [1][6] - The ice and snow industry is projected to grow from 381.1 billion yuan in 2020 to 970 billion yuan by 2024, reflecting an annual growth rate of 26.3% [1] Sports Events Economy - The popularity of grassroots events like "Su Chao" and "Village Super" has surged, with significant media attention and public engagement [3] - In the first half of the year, key events in seven regions generated over 16 billion yuan in related consumption, averaging over 30 million yuan per event [3] - Major events like the Hangzhou Asian Games have led to consumption increases of over 40% in surrounding areas [4] Infrastructure and Accessibility - Jiangsu province's robust economic strength and infrastructure have facilitated the success of large-scale sports events, with many cities equipped with large-capacity sports venues [5] - The government has invested 5.65 billion yuan to support the opening of public sports venues, enhancing community access to sports facilities [5] Transformation of the Sports Industry - The sports service sector's contribution to the sports industry's value added has increased from 68.7% in 2020 to 72.7% in 2023, indicating a shift towards service-oriented growth [6] - The number of national-level "specialized, refined, distinctive, and innovative" small giant enterprises in the sports sector has more than doubled to 146 by the end of 2024 [6] Consumer Trends and Market Dynamics - The rise of domestic manufacturing has significantly reduced costs for sports products, such as carbon fiber bicycles, making them more accessible to consumers [7][8] - The diversification of sports consumption patterns is evident, with increased participation in events like marathons and local sports activities [8] - The number of events is expected to rise from 699 to 749, with participant numbers increasing from 6.05 million to 7.05 million in 2023-2024 [8]
奋力迈向体育强国
Jing Ji Ri Bao· 2025-08-19 22:04
Core Insights - The article highlights the achievements in building a sports power during the "14th Five-Year Plan" period in China, emphasizing the growth of mass fitness and the integration of sports with various sectors [1][2]. Group 1: Mass Fitness Development - During the "14th Five-Year Plan" period, mass fitness has seen significant progress, with national sports venue area reaching 4.23 billion square meters, an increase of 1.131 billion square meters compared to the end of the "13th Five-Year Plan" [2] - The "2025 National Fitness Day" recently held saw over 22,000 events with more than 11 million participants, indicating a growing trend of public engagement in fitness activities [2] - The rise of local competitions, such as "village competitions" and "city competitions," has fostered community engagement and consumption, promoting a culture of fitness and health [2] Group 2: Sports Event Economy - The "14th Five-Year Plan" period has witnessed numerous large-scale sports events that enhance city image and stimulate consumption, with 511 monitored events in seven regions generating over 16 billion yuan in related consumption [4] - The sports event market is expanding, with ticket sales for popular events like CBA and WTT seeing significant demand, and the China Open tennis tournament generating over 80 million yuan in ticket revenue last year [4] - The integration of sports events with culture, commerce, and tourism is creating a "golden combination" for driving consumption and expanding domestic demand [5] Group 3: Competitive Sports Achievements - China's competitive sports have achieved remarkable success on the international stage, with an increase in Olympic qualification projects from 21 to 24, reflecting balanced development across various sports [6][7] - The "633" development strategy aims to strengthen six key sports while enhancing the competitiveness of foundational sports and revitalizing team sports [7][8] - Competitive sports are seen as a catalyst for promoting mass sports and youth engagement, contributing to economic and social development [8]
